Karasako
Karasako is a locality in Mifune Machi, Kamimashiki district, Kumamoto. Karasako is situated nearby to the locality Haidoko, as well as near Asanoyabu.Places in the Area

Nishihara
Village
Nishihara is a village located in Aso District, Kumamoto Prefecture, Japan. As of 31 August 2024, the village had an estimated population of 7035 in 3044 households, and a population density of 91 persons per km2. The total area of the village is 77.22 km2. Nishihara is situated 5 km northeast of Karasako.
Mashiki
Town
Photo: Sanjo, Public domain.
Mashiki is a town located in Kamimashiki District, Kumamoto Prefecture, Japan. As of 31 August 2024, the town had an estimated population of 34,118 in 14750 households, and a population density of 520 persons per km2. Mashiki is situated 9 km west of Karasako.
